Output 23e4de9771a54ab4e8d95d05b6a19d6628d2c3cce5ef2e2e857c13261d627d90:1

value
23594188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60bf6638bb7237f7562d4daa88a81614df22dbd4 OP_EQUAL
address
3AWa5ch9Vm8ps9naME3E6CffEgCQsP9u5s
transaction
23e4de9771a54ab4e8d95d05b6a19d6628d2c3cce5ef2e2e857c13261d627d90
spent
true